摘要
We present the first result for the hyperon vector form factor f(1) for Xi(0) -> Sigma(+)l (v) over bar and Sigma(=)-> nl (v) over bar semileptonic decays from fully dynamical lattice QCD. The calculations are carried out with gauge configurations generated by the RBC and UKQCD collaborations with (2 + 1)-flavors of dynamical domain-wall fermions and the Iwasaki gauge action at beta = 2.13, corresponding to a cutoff a(-1) = 1.73 GeV. Our results, which are calculated at the lighter three sea quark masses (the lightest pion mass down to approximately 330 MeV), show that a sign of the second-order correction of SU(3) breaking on the hyperon vector coupling f(1)(0) is negative. The tendency of the SU(3)-breaking correction observed in this work disagrees with predictions of both the latest baryon chiral perturbation theory result and large N-c analysis.
